A mouse DNA sequence that mediates integration and excision of polyoma virus DNA

Gene. 1984 Sep;29(3):343-50. doi: 10.1016/0378-1119(84)90063-5.

Abstract

In mouse cells transformed by a temperature-sensitive polyoma virus (Py) genome, the integrated viral genome recombines with adjacent chromosomal DNA to yield a small cyclic molecule (RmI) with defined viral and cellular components. We have cloned the cellular component (Ins), determined its sequence, and examined its distribution in normal mouse DNA. The sequence of Ins displays several homologies with that surrounding the replication origin (ori) of Py or SV40 DNA.
